Hello from Connecticut!

I'm so happy I found this incredible forum!

I worked as a professional cook in restaurants for 7 years making it all the way up to Sous Chef and then made the switch to pastry arts (mainly because often, the other chefs I worked with understandably wanted nothing to do with baking). After specializing in chocolate sculpture and wedding cakes for 3 years, I "retired" from the business to start a family and now teach both savory cooking and pastry classes.

I also feed my creative side by painting in oils and sculpting in glass.

I am looking forward to meeting you all and becoming an active member here!
